miR-372 and miR-373
Following Hippo signalling , large tumour
suppressor (LATS) phosphorylates and inhibits YAP and TAZ; this is prevented by high levels of miR-372 and miR-373, which target LATS
miR 125b
example of a miRNA operating as a primary mediator of default repression.
In a normal cell miR-125b targets residual p53 activity, avoiding apoptosis. Following
genotoxic inputs p53 is activated and miR-125b is repressed, inducing apoptosis.
let-7 miRNA differentiation
example of microRNAs and signaling gradients
let-7 expression increases during differentiation, resulting in
progressive inhibition of RAS signalling. This enables self-renewal in progenitor cells but restrains it while cells differentiate.
miRNAs in bistable fate choices
n a cell, a transcription factor
(TF) inhibits the expression of a miRNA; in turn, the miRNA inhibits expression of the TF. The cell can adopt two alternative
fates: state A is the default fate, in which miRNA expression dominates and the expression of the TF is turned off. In state B,
an extrinsic cue (signal) stabilizes the TF, promoting cell differentiation and leading to repression of the miRNA and give a
different cellular outcome
